About D. Barrie Johnson
D. Barrie Johnson is a scholar working on Water Science and Technology, Environmental Chemistry and Analytical Chemistry, having authored 5 papers that have together received 194 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Metal Extraction and Bioleaching (4 papers), Minerals Flotation and Separation Techniques (4 papers) and Mine drainage and remediation techniques (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Environmental Chemistry (58 citations), Water Science and Technology (79 citations) and Biomedical Engineering (137 citations). D. Barrie Johnson has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, Chile and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Kevin B. Hallberg, Catherine Joulian, Patrick d’Hugues, Igor Tolstoy, Jana Seifert, Lillian G. Acuña, Yuri I. Wolf, Raquel Quatrini, Sabrina Hedrich and Kira S. Makarova. Their work appears in journals such as International Biodeterioration & Biodegradation, Extremophiles and Minerals.
